
Write some of the important slogans given by different political parties in various elections.

Complete answer:
'Garibi Hatao' was given by The Congress party. It was led by Indira Gandhi. The slogan was given in the 1971 Lok Sabha elections.
'Save Democracy' was the slogan given by the Janata Party. It was led by JP Narayan. The Lok Sabha election held in 1977 was when this slogan was said.
'Land to the Tiller' was given by the Left Front party in the 1977 West Bengal Assembly elections.
'Protect the Self-Respect of the Telugus' used in 1983 elections by N. T. Rama Rao. He was the leader of the Telugu Desam Party.
'Bari Bari Sab Ki Bari, Ab Ki Bari Atal Bihari' was given by the BJP in the 1996 Lok Sabha elections.
'Sonia Nahi Ye Aandhi Hai, Doosri Indira Gandhi Hai' was the slogan by the Congress party to popularize Sonia Gandhi in the 2009 elections.
'Abki Baar Modi Sarkar' by Bharatiya Janata Party in the 2014 general elections.
